WebRough-in Size. The rough-in size is the distance between the wall and the center of the floor drain. 10-inch rough-in Toilets. 12-inch rough-in Toilets. 14-inch rough-in Toilets. Wall-Mounted Toilets. Bowl Height. Standard bowl height is about 15 inches from floor to seat. Chair-height toilets sit 2–4” higher. WebApr 15, 2024 · A tankless toilet relies on the supply line’s high water pressure to push the waste down the drain. It uses an electric pump to boost the flushing power. The water … WebA standard commercial chrome flush valve or "flushometer" for a toilet is designed to be connected to a 1inch diameter water line. Depending on your specific home, you may not have any piping larger than 3/4 inch in diameter anywhere.
